Liverpool Vs Man City: Reds’ predicted lineup against Manchester City, as they host the Citizens for the title race clash on 12th game-week.
Manchester City will visit the Anfield stadium to play the next Premier League match, which has been deemed as the title race clash as Liverpool and Manchester City are on the 1st and 2nd spot of the table respectively.
Only a gap of 6 points separates them and a favourable result to any side will bring a new dimension to the league. Either Liverpool will march ahead with the 9 points gap or Manchester City’s win will make the league wide open.
Even a draw will bring a drastic change to the league, as it will allow Leicester City and Chelsea to level with Manchester City and come closer to Liverpool, provided the former two sides will win their respective matches.
Thus, the title race will no longer be between two teams and can have Chelsea as a huge contender for the laurel. Amidst all of this, Liverpool has more chance of grabbing three points since the game is in Liverpool and the Reds have an impeccable record over there. Plus, it provides a hostile environment to the visitors.
Liverpool is expected to lineup their strongest 11 and with the most of the squad is fit except for Joel Matip, the Reds will field a strong opposition. On the other side, Manchester City’s plan is tough to predict with no clarity over goalkeeper amidst Ederson’s injury.
Meanwhile, apart from Raheem Sterling and Kevin De Bruyne, every other position sounds doubtful ahead of the Liverpool clash in the Premier League.

Liverpool’s predicted lineup against Manchester City
Alisson; Robertson, Van Dijk, Lovren, Alexander Arnold; Henderson, Fabinho, Wijnaldum; Mane, Firmino, Salah
